WebDry surgical scrub brushes, on the other hand, require only the brush itself, making them a more affordable option in the long run. Gentler on Skin. Dry surgical scrub brushes are also gentler on skin than traditional wet scrubbing methods. With wet scrubbing, the constant exposure to water and soap can cause skin irritation and dryness. Web13 okt. 2024 · During a surgical procedure, scrub techs are usually the first team members to scrub in. After doing so, they set out necessary instruments, ensure they’re sterilized, position the patient on the operating table, and arrange sterile drapes ensuring the surgical field is exposed.
